trusha patel ★☆☆☆☆
Unbelievable how the standards have dropped at Royal China. Once a bustling restaurant was was all but empty yesterday and I can only think it's the quality of the food. This restaurant uses the cheapest ingredients, and bulks up food with cheap ingredients. We ordered stir fried foods and it mostly contained chunky onions. Aubergine peels were mixed with few pieces of aubergine, cucumber for the duck came as peels because the cucumber flesh was used to make some other dish. It seems the chef was given a challenge to make as many dishes from 1 vegetable as possible. The lettuce for lettuce wrap was limp and old. Even cheap Chinese buffet restaurants serve better quality of food than Royal China. The only nice thing about the restaurant was the staff.

Yasir ★★★★☆
I am a regular here for lunch, that dim sum menu is something special. We got the prawn and chive dumplings, prawn dumplings, prawn cheung fun, sesame prawn toast (my favourite), soft shell crab, salt and pepper fried green beans and squid in black bean sauce. The squid wasn’t great as it was too chewy but everyone else was on point and delicious. Make sure to ask for a bowl to mix some soy sauce and chilli oil in! Our total bill was £60 which is reasonable. Came back for dinner, unfortunately they don’t do many dumplings for dinner and one of the servers isn’t the nicest. We got the szichaun prawns which were good but the portion of prawns was quite low. I have amended my rating to 4 stars.
